Driving Alternatives to Animal Testing in Personal Care and Chemical Safety
The personal care, cosmetic, and chemical industries have undergone a major transformation in safety and efficacy testing, driven largely by regulatory shifts and evolving consumer values. Regulatory frameworks—most notably the European Union’s cosmetics testing ban and the global adoption of REACH guidelines—have restricted or prohibited traditional in vivo animal testing for skin irritation, corrosion, and sensitization. In response, validated in vitro alternatives utilizing cultured human skin cells have become the global standard for safety evaluation.
Primary human keratinocytes, cultivated in specialized growth media, serve as the primary component of bioengineered 3D human skin models. These tissue constructs allow safety assessment teams to perform realistic toxicology screenings:
-
In Vitro Irritation Testing: Assesses cellular viability and cytotoxicity following chemical exposure.
-
Skin Sensitization Assays: Measures cytokine release and gene biomarker expression to detect potential allergic reactions.
-
Phototoxicity Evaluations: Evaluates cellular responses when test compounds are exposed to ultraviolet light.
-
Efficacy Screening: Examines anti-aging compounds, barrier-repairing lipid synthesis, and wound-healing acceleration.
Because non-animal safety assays depend on consistent cellular behavior, media quality directly impacts testing accuracy. Culture media must maintain uniform cellular morphology and metabolic activity across test batches to ensure results meet international OECD test guidelines.
As cosmetic brands expand their investments in active ingredient development and natural formulation screening, the demand for specialized cell culture reagents continues to climb.
